Chanel May 5, 2005–August 7, 2005 Special Exhibition Galleries, 1st floor |
One of the most revered designers of the 20th century, Coco Chanel (1883–1971) made an enduring impact on the fashion world. It is the authority and mastery of her work, the resonance of her image of the modern woman as articulated in her designs, and the autobiographical infusion of influences in her collections that confirm her iconic stature. In this exhibition, the spirit of the House of Chanel echoes vibrantly with an unprecedented presentation of more than 50 designs and accessories from the Museum’s Costume Institute collection, Chanel Archives, and other international institutions such as the Victoria and Albert Museum in London. |

| GLAMOUR: FASHION TO DIE FOR AT THE MUSEUM AT FIT
|  |  |
 |  | Glamour: Fashion, Film, Fantasy,
an exhibition on view February 15 through April 9, 2005, features
approximately 100 ultra-glamorous fashions, including dresses worn by
stars such as Marlene Dietrich, Marilyn Monroe, and Madonna. This
exhibition has been made possible through the support of Target.
Combining "sex appeal plus luxury plus elegance plus romance,"
as glamour was described by a Hollywood writer, these clothes are not
for the shy. It would be hard to hide in the leopard print chiffon gown
trimmed with feathers designed by Galanos and worn by Rosalind Russell,
or the brilliant red evening dress by Schiaparelli for Rita Hayworth.
Shimmering white satin, glittering sequins, and gold lame are
quintessentially glamorous.

| RICO PUHLMANN: A FASHION LEGACY, 1955-1995
|  |  |
 |  | February 8, 2005 through April 9, 2005
The
artistry of Rico Puhlmann (1934-1996), fashion photographer,
illustrator, and occasional filmmaker and designer, whose career in
Europe and America spanned more than 40 years, is on view at The Museum
at FIT, February 8 through April 9, 2005. This is his first major
retrospective, featuring more than 200 photographs, drawings, sketches,
magazine layouts, covers, tear sheets, and films.
